Skip to main content
Restoration Services
Near You
About
Contact
Pricing
(opens in new tab)
Apply Now
Toggle menu
Home
Browse by Location
California
Walnut Creek
Businesses in Walnut Creek, CA
3 businesses found
All Star Mold Testing & Water Damage Inc. (formerly Servpro of Walnut Creek)
Walnut Creek, CA 94595
(800) 813-7704
View Profile
Nearby Locations
Acampo
Agoura Hills
Alhambra
Aliso Viejo
American Canyon
Anaheim
Antioch
Apple Valley
Arcadia
Arcata
Artesia
Atascadero
Featured Categories
Asbestos Testing Service
Crime Scene Cleanup
Water Damage Restoration
Iphone Repair Pro
Walnut Creek, CA 94596
(925) 428-7301
View Profile
Fresh Environment - Water Damage Restoration Service in Walnut Creek CA
Walnut Creek, CA 94596
(925) 234-4726
View Profile